One of the primary strategies involves the use of sustainable materials. Choosing locally sourced, recycled, or renewable materials reduces the carbon footprint associated with transportation and production. For instance, reclaimed bricks and salvaged stone not only avoid the environmental costs of new production but also bring historical character and unique aesthetics to new projects. Using supplementary cementitious materials like fly ash or slag cement in the production of concrete also reduces the reliance on traditional Portland cement, which is a significant source of CO2 emissions.
Energy efficiency is another cornerstone of sustainable masonry practices. During restoration projects, effective insulation techniques are used to enhance building energy efficiency. Utilizing materials with superior thermal mass, such as masonry walls, helps maintain indoor temperature and reduce reliance on heating and cooling systems. The choice of lighter materials for exterior finishes or integrating green building practices, such as living walls, further contribute to energy conservation.
Waste management practices are integral to eco-friendly masonry. Reducing, reusing, and recycling demolition waste significantly cuts down landfill usage. James T. Coughlan Restoration implements on-site sorting systems to ensure that as much material as possible is recycled or reused. This not only prevents waste but also often leads to financial savings, which can be passed on to clients.
